Portfolio-Focused PMO Anne Milkovich Associate CIO for Enterprise IT Governance, Montana State University Oversees the PMO, governance, service management, planning, policy, finance, human resources 20 years experience in IT prior to entering higher education Doctoral student in Higher Education Administration researching the application of portfolio theory to improve institutional performance Designed and implemented MSU’s first — and most successful! — PMO Portfolio-Focused PMO January 28, 2014

Project Management delivers the objective in time, in scope, in budget Portfolio Management decides what objectives to deliver Maximize Value, Minimize Risk, Assure Transparency January 28, 2014 Portfolio-Focused PMO

Portfolio-Focused PMO Portfolio Management Manage portfolio of organizational investments to achieve strategic objectives Balance risk & reward Balance transactional & transformational Optimize alignment across objectives Portfolio-Focused PMO January 28, 2014

PMO Portfolio Focus at MSU Facilitate intake, evaluation, selection, prioritization of constituent demand Guide portfolio optimization Support distributed project managers Report results to stakeholders IT projects and administrative initiatives Portfolio-Focused PMO January 28, 2014

PMO Staffing Associate CIO Portfolio Manager Communications Specialist Governance, planning, policy, service mgt, finance, HR Portfolio Manager Portfolio, PMO management, high-risk programs Project Manager Communications Specialist Project Manager Internal projects, PM support Web development, SharePoint, communications Internal projects, program support Portfolio-Focused PMO January 28, 2014

Governance Enterprise Council Bozeman Chair: Provost Billings Chair: Budget Director Great Falls Chair: CFO Havre Chair: CIO Bozeman Council Provost VP Admin & Fin VP Research VP Student Dean Rep Student Rep Billings Council Chancellor’s Cabinet Great Falls Council CFO CIO Havre Council Cabinet Faculty Portfolio-Focused PMO January 28, 2014

Portfolio-Focused PMO Process Overview Portfolio-Focused PMO January 28, 2014

Portfolio-Focused PMO Intake Gather high-level concept from requester Complete business case Cost-Benefit-Risk-Alignment analysis “T-shirt sizing” Portfolio-Focused PMO January 28, 2014

Portfolio-Focused PMO Evaluate Pre-defined scoring rubric Consistent scoring team Don’t over-analyze Portfolio-Focused PMO January 28, 2014

Portfolio-Focused PMO Select & Prioritize Plot scores in bubble chart Illustrates Alignment Value (bang for the buck) Probability of Success (risk) Visual illustration for human judgment Portfolio-Focused PMO January 28, 2014
